Ca(Mg2Al)(SiAl3)O10(OH)2 (Ca0.97Mg2.18Fe0.11Al3.38Si1.32O10[OH]1.55F0.45) Crystal Structure
General Information
- Phase Label(s): Ca0.97Mg2.18Fe0.11Al3.38Si1.32O10[OH]1.55F0.45
- Structure Class(es): mica family
- Classification by Properties: –
- Mineral Name(s): clintonite
- Pearson Symbol: mS40
- Space Group: 12
- Phase Prototype: KMg3(Al0.25Si0.75)4O10([OH]0.5F0.5)2
- Measurement Detail(s): automatic diffractometer; 14 (determination of cell parameters), X-rays, Mo Kα1 (determination of cell parameters)
- Phase Class(es): –
- Compound Class(es): hydroxide, silicate, fluoride
- Interpretation Detail(s): cell parameters determined
- Sample Detail(s): clintonite sample from U.S.A. New York, Orange County, Warwick, electron microprobe analysis; 12.84 wt.% CaO, 17.77 wt.% SiO2, 42.57 wt.% Al2O3, 18.92 wt.% MgO, 3.08 wt.% FeO, single crystal (determination of cell parameters)
Substance Summary
- Standard Formula: CaMg2Fe0.2Al3.5Si1.3O10[OH]1.7F0.3
- Alphabetic Formula: Al3.5CaF0.3Fe0.2Mg2O10[OH]1.7Si1.3
- Published Formula: Ca(Mg2Al)(SiAl3)O10(OH)2
- Refined Formula: –
- Wyckoff Sequence: –
- Z Formula Units: 2
